3 What is the PSAT 8/9 An assessment given to 8th and 9th grade students which is aligned with the SAT Suite of Assessments. It tests students in the areas of Math, Reading and Writing. It is an early indicator of college readiness It provides detailed performance feedback connected to classroom teaching standards. Will provide early access to career exploration tools Benefits The PSAT 8/9 establishes a baseline measurement of college and career readiness as students enter high school. It also gives students a chance to preview the SAT, PSAT/NMSQT, and PSAT 10 and connect to AP courses. Math, reading and writing areas are based on real world applications. For parents it is an early indicator for college readiness. It tells you at this point if your child is on track for college. Since the test is based on common core standards, it connects to the classroom teachings. Taking the test gives students access to on-line career exploration tools.

12 How to get ready for the PSAT 8/9
Practice classroom skills and learning daily On the test day, answer the questions to the best of his or her ability. There is no penalty for guessing. Visit the collegeboard website to view sample questions. Have a good breakfast the day of the test. Get plenty of sleep the night before.

13 What to bring the day of the test
Bring 2 #2 pencils. NO Mechanical pencils allowed An approved calculator: Four-function calculator Scientific calculator Graphing calculator Make sure Your child knows the following: Birthdate Address (many students don’t know this) 4 digit ID #
